Christian Git
A Christian wrapper for Git to sanctify your version control.
What is this?
Install this package and you'll have a collection of Christian Git commands and aliases at your fingertips (which were miraculously knitted together in your mother's womb). Using the christian-git
command, you can completely eliminate the need to call git
on your machine. If a Christian version of a command doesn't exist, it'll fall back to use the actual command provided by Git.
For example, running christian-git testimony
calls git log
, and christian-git crucify some-branch
calls git branch -D some-branch
.
Each of these commands will respect any flags you include, passing them through to the underlying Git command.
Commands
Commands that override core Git commands.
Heathen Command | Redeemed Command | Explanation |
---|---|---|
add | anoint | Your code's been anointed by God to be saved. |
blame | judas | Truly I tell you, one of you will betray me. |
branch | vine | He is the vine, we are the branches. |
checkout | possess | Resurrect what was once alive. |
clone | bread-and-fish | Jesus fed the 5000 with five loaves and two fish. |
commit | save | Commit your code to the Lord and it will be saved. |
diff | reform | The repo reformed, always being reformed by the power of the Admin. |
fetch | fishers-of-men | Become a fisher of (the code of) men. |
help | cry-out | And the terminal will have mercy. |
init | create | Before this, there was nothing. |
init | in-the-beginning | Start us off, God. |
log | testimony | Use your code's testimony to share the path the Lord has led you along. |
merge | trinity | Father, Son, and Holy Spirit. Three in One. |
pull | petition | Petition the Lord through prayer to grant you those remote code changes. |
push | preach | Proudly declare your Gospel code to those who need it. |
rebase | disciple | Regularly examine your code, words and actions and compare them with the Word of God. |
reflog | resurrect | Resurrect what was once alive. |
reset | ark | God hit reset on the earth. |
revert | repent | Turn back from your sinful ways. |
stash | sow-and-reap | Regularly sow your code so that you may reap its blessings later. |
stash | bear-cross | Let Him bear the burden. |
status | walk | How's your code's walk with the Lord? |
tag | testament | God's way of semantic versioning. |
tag | circumcise | A snip, er — sign that you’ve been set apart. symbol. |
bisect | lost-sheep | Become the good shepherd and find those led astray. |
Alias
Aliases that provide shorthand means of running more complex commands (basically anything that require extra flags).
Aliases
Heathen Command | Redeemed Alias | Explanation |
---|---|---|
branch -D | crucify | Delete the branch that no longer bears fruit. |
push --force | indoctrinate | Force the theology of your code onto the vulnerable and gullable. |
Installation
npm install christian-git -g
or
yarn global add christian-git
Usage
Whenever you'd normally use git
, use christian-git
instead, followed by whatever command or alias and any flags you'd like to pass.
Some More Examples
Pagan: git pull origin/master
Righteous: christian-git petition origin/master
Pagan: git status
Righteous: christian-git walk
Pagan: git log --pretty=format:"%h - %an, %ar : %s"
Righteous: christian-git testimony --pretty=format:"%h - %an, %ar : %s"
